Ingredients

For the pickle brine:

  • 500ml of dill pickle juice (this can be store-bought or homemade)
  • 2 tablespoons of sugar
  • 1 tablespoon of black peppercorns
  • 1 teaspoon of gar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on of onion powder
  • 1 teaspoon of mustard seeds (optional)

For the chicken wings:

  • 1kg of chicken wings, separated into drums and flats
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 1 teaspoon of baking powder (for added crispiness)

For the dipping sauce (optional):

  • 100g of mayo
  • 2 tablespoons of Dijon mustard
  • 1 tablespoon of pickle juice
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ions

1. Brine the Chicken Wings:
Start by placing the chicken wings in a large zip-lock bag or a deep bowl. In a separate jug, combine the pickle juice, sugar, black peppercorns, garlic powder, onion powder, and mustard seeds (if using). Pour the brine over the wings, ensuring they are well covered. Seal the bag or cover the bowl and refrigerate for at least 2 hours, but ideally overnight. The longer they brine, the more flavour they will absorb.

2. Prepare for Air Frying:
After the wings have finished brining, remove them from the refrigerator and drain the brine. Pat the wings dry with kitchen paper to remove excess moisture. This step is crucial for achieving a golden, crispy texture. Once dry, season them with a pinch of salt, pepper, and baking powder, ensuring they are evenly coated.

3. Preheat the Air Fryer:
Preheat your air fryer to 200°C (390°F) for about 5 minutes. Preheating ensures that your wings start cooking as soon as you place them inside, maximising their crispiness.

4. Air Fry the Chicken Wings:
Place the seasoned wings in the air fryer basket in a single layer, ensuring they are not overcrowded. You may need to cook them in batches, depending on the size of your air fryer. Cook the wings for 25-30 minutes, shaking the basket halfway through to ensure even cooking. They should be golden brown and fully cooked, reaching an internal temperature of 75°C (165°F).

5. Make the Dipping Sauce (Optional):
While the wings are cooking, you can whip up a quick dipping sauce if desired. In a small bowl, mix together the mayo, Dijon mustard, pickle juice, salt, and pepper. Adjust the seasoning according to your taste.

6. Serve and Enjoy:
Once cooked, remove the chicken wings from the air fryer and let them rest for a few minutes. Serve them hot with the dipping sauce on the side for a tangy complement to your wings.
